Second Interim Report of the Tribunal of Inquiry into Certain Planning Matters and Payments: Statements.

 

The Minister said the Government has done everything possible to facilitate the work of the Flood tribunal. It is a pity the Taoiseach has not been upfront and answered a straight question. The Minister engaged in double speak today, as the Taoiseach has done on a number of occasions. At the time, it was imperative the Taoiseach send out the message loud and clear that Mr. Burke would be forced out of the Cabinet if the rumours were substantiated. Instead, he covered for Mr. Burke stating that a good man was being hounded. Even at this late stage, the Taoiseach should come forward and declare what he knows.
